Search results view:
Delivery time

ADJ134336 BLUE PRINT Disco de freno

Part number ADJ134336
Brand BLUE PRINT
Name Disco de freno
Weight 7.17
Brand Part number
TATA MOTORS 271942103701, 271942103702, 288842103703